Former ENHYPEN Member Heeseung’s Solo Debut Reaches Major Milestone

Former ENHYPEN member Heeseung, who has reintroduced himself as Evan, has achieved a significant milestone with his debut solo single, Ride Or Die. Released on June 22, the music video’s official YouTube upload has crossed 11.3 million views, marking a strong start to his solo career.


The achievement reflects the strong interest surrounding Evan’s new musical direction after departing the globally popular K-pop group.

‘Ride Or Die’ Receives Strong Online Attention

Ride Or Die showcases Evan’s emotional and artistic evolution as a solo performer. The track highlights a different musical identity from his previous work, focusing on a more personal style.

While many fans welcomed the new chapter in his career, reactions online have been mixed. Supporters praised the song’s emotional depth and congratulated the singer on his long-awaited solo debut, while some listeners expressed reservations about its production style.

Despite the divided opinions, the music video has continued to attract millions of viewers within days of its release.

Heeseung Earlier Addressed His Exit From ENHYPEN

Following his departure from ENHYPEN earlier this year, Evan shared a heartfelt message with fans, thanking both his former bandmates and supporters for standing by him throughout his journey.

He explained that the decision came after extensive discussions with his agency and that he wanted to explore his own artistic ambitions while maintaining deep respect and affection for the group.

In his message, Evan also acknowledged fans’ concerns and promised to return with music that reflects his personal growth as an artist.
